The Duyckinck family played a significant role in the literary and cultural life of New York City in the mid-19th century. Evert A. Duyckinck (1816-1878) and his brother George L. Duyckinck (1823-1863) were both authors, editors, and publishers. They were known for their literary criticism and their promotion of American literature. The Duyckinck Family Papers include letters, manuscripts, diaries, and other materials related to the family's literary and publishing activities.
